Subject: Quickstore 4.2 — bloom filter now fronts the KV layer

Plugin authors: starting with this release, Quickstore places a bloom filter ahead of the key-value store. Negative lookups return faster; false positives fall through safely. No API changes are required on your side. Verify your plugin against the staging build referenced below.

session token of fahif-tadup = htk3_9c7

Ticket: Staging env misconfigured for Siftgate bloom filter

The bloom layer in front of the Pellet KV store is rejecting all lookups in staging because the env file was copied from the dev template without credentials. False-positive tuning values are fine; only the auth line is missing. To unblock the weekly demo, the Pellet admission secret must be set on the following line.

env line for yaguf-fajop: LEDGER_TOKEN13=fb08984397349

**09:41** — Gridfall export worker OOM-killed on a 400k-row spreadsheet. Root cause: full sheet buffered in memory instead of streamed. Hotfix switched exporter to chunked writes; peak usage dropped from 6 GB to 300 MB. Verified against the Penhollow tenant's largest workbook. The build token for the hotfix is noted below.

build token for kagaf-hahof: htk14_9d3d4d26d7d8de

RESTOCKR PLUGIN HOOKS — restock planner. Plugins must register a route solver before calling plan(). The Fillgrid core recomputes machine demand hourly; do not cache slot counts longer than that window. Failed syncs to the Cartwheel depot service retry three times, then dead-letter. Validate payloads against schema v4 or the planner silently drops your bids. All plugin calls to the internal inventory oracle require authentication; sandbox credentials are rotated weekly and distributed via the portal. Use the key below for staging requests.

API key for yahig-tadup: kto7_ubizbYm